More than 240 hectares to be covered by the project in the mountains

The Institute for Forests and Nature Conservation (IFCN) has been stepping up the active management of Madeira’s public forest areas, having carried out work on around 240.8 hectares since the start of 2026 through measures to reduce fuel load, preventative silviculture, the control of invasive species and reforestation with ecologically adapted species. Hotels use 70 per cent of desalinated water

The Porto Santo Desalination Plant is preparing to increase its production capacity to 10,000 cubic metres of water per day, thereby strengthening the security of the island’s drinking water supply. More than 81 per cent of Madeira’s territorial waters are protected

The Autonomous Region of Madeira marked World Oceans Day by reaffirming its commitment to marine conservation and sustainable development, highlighting that over 81 per cent of its maritime area is protected. Madeira may bring forward its renewable energy target

The Autonomous Region of Madeira may bring forward its target of achieving 55 per cent renewable energy penetration – initially set for 2030 – after recording a rate of 56 per cent in the first quarter of 2026.
